What is a warehouse associate trainer?

Warehouse Associate Trainers are experienced warehouse employees responsible for onboarding, instructing, and mentoring new associates. They teach proper safety protocols, operational procedures, and the use of equipment to ensure new hires are competent and compliant with company standards. Their role is crucial in maintaining productivity and safety within the warehouse by ensuring all team members are well-trained and knowledgeable.

How does a warehouse associate trainer balance training new hires while maintaining warehouse productivity?

As a Warehouse Associate Trainer, you play a dual role: ensuring new team members are thoroughly trained on processes and safety standards while also supporting daily warehouse operations. This often involves hands-on instruction during actual shifts, shadowing, and gradually transitioning trainees to independent work. Trainers must be adept at time management and communication, frequently coordinating with supervisors to align training schedules with workflow demands. Balancing these responsibilities helps maintain productivity without compromising the quality of onboarding, and fosters a supportive learning environment for new hires.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a warehouse associate trainer?

To thrive as a Warehouse Associate Trainer, you need in-depth knowledge of warehouse operations, safety protocols, and training methodologies, often supported by experience in warehouse roles and occasionally a relevant certification such as OSHA. Familiarity with warehouse management systems (WMS), inventory tracking software, and training delivery platforms is typically required. Excellent communication, patience, and leadership skills help you effectively teach and motivate trainees from diverse backgrounds. These skills are crucial for ensuring that new associates are well-prepared, safe, and productive, directly impacting operational efficiency and workplace safety.

Job description

Warehouse Associate

Vortex Industries, America's highest quality and most customer-centric commercial and industrial door repair company, is seeking a dedicated and detail-oriented Warehouse Associate to join our team.

As a Warehouse Associate, you will play a vital role in ensuring the efficient operation of our warehouse, including tasks such as receiving, storing, loading/unloading trucks, managing inventory, conducting material pick-ups, monitoring inventory, and performing general shop maintenance, as well as maintaining a clean and organized workspace. Your contribution will directly impact our ability to meet customer demands and deliver exceptional service.

Responsibilities:

  • Unloading trucks and checking in material.
  • Material pickup and drop-offs.
  • Sort and place materials on racks, shelves or in bins according to organizational standards.
  • Maintain and manage inventory levels of product and equipment.
  • Operate machinery like forklifts.
  • Receive and process materials.
  • Maintains safe and clean work environment by keeping shelves, pallet area, and workstations neat; Sweep, dust and mop. Organize warehouse and work area for orderliness at all times.
  • Support any Safety programs and be a safety advocate at the Service Center.
  • Support management with any safety training at the Service Center.
  • Complete safety walks and provide feedback to the safety team.
  • Wear the proper safety equipment.
